Rick, most vehicles had a pressure sensor to prohibit the a/c compressor from engaging unless sufficient refrigerant is contained within the system. This protects your a/c compressor from "running dry". You need to take it to someone or somewhere to have your a/c refrigerant charge checked with gauges before any further troubleshooting can be accomplished.
